How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Strawberry Plains?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Strawberry Plains Studio Apartments | $1,429 | $800 | $1,850 |
| Strawberry Plains 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,483 | $875 | $3,678 |
| Strawberry Plains 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,610 | $950 | $3,385 |
| Strawberry Plains 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,858 | $799 | $2,785 |
| Strawberry Plains 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,502 | $1,495 | $2,793 |
